Building Trust and Communication

Before engaging in lick sex or any form of intimate exploration, it’s essential to communicate openly with your partner. Trust is the foundation of intimacy, and open lines of communication ensure both partners feel comfortable and excited about their sexual encounters. Here are some tips to foster that atmosphere:

1. Make Consent a Priority

The act of licking someone’s body is an intimate exchange that demands consent. Make an agreement with your partner about what is comfortable and pleasurable for both of you. This not only heightens trust but also enhances the experience when both partners are fully engaged.

2. Discuss Preferences and Boundaries

Before embarking on your sensual journey, have an open conversation about likes, dislikes, and boundaries. Understanding what turns you both on and off can lead to a more pleasurable experience. Discuss specific areas of the body that are sensitive to licking, and be sure to revisit this conversation as experiences and preferences may evolve.

3. Create a Safe Space

Choose a comfortable environment where both partners can relax. The atmosphere can significantly enhance the experience, allowing you to explore freely without distractions. Consider using soft lighting, warming scents, or relaxing music to set the mood.

The Sensual Techniques of Lick Sex

Lick sex can take many forms, from the lightest caress of the tongue to deeper, more passionate exploration. Here are some techniques to add depth and excitement to your experiences:

1. The Art of Kissing

Kissing is often the gateway to more intimate acts. Start slow, letting your lips tease and explore. Utilize your tongue to add variety—gently taste, flick, and caress your partner’s lips and tongue. Experiment with the pressure and speed of your movements, allowing the rhythm of your kiss to dictate the pace.

Expert Tip: Dr. Berman suggests whispering sweet nothings between kisses. It builds emotional connection and provides an added layer of intimacy.

2. Erogenous Zone Exploration

Beyond the lips, many areas of the body can be heightened with licking. Here are some key spots to consider:

  • The Neck: Soft, gentle licks under the ear or along the nape can induce goosebumps and increase arousal.

  • The Nipple Area: Use your tongue in circular motions or gentle flicks. Experiment with pressure to discover what your partner enjoys.

  • Inner Thighs: Trace your tongue along the sensitive inner thighs—this can be a tantalizing tease that heightens arousal.

  • Back and Spine: Gently lick along the spine to stimulate sensitive nerve endings, increasing anticipation.

Example: One couple reported that utilizing licking techniques along the spine enhanced both their emotional connection and physical pleasure, leading to a more powerful climax.

3. Using Temperature Play

Incorporating elements of temperature can drastically change the experience of lick sex. Consider the following:

  • Ice Cubes: Use crushed ice or ice cubes in your mouth before licking your partner’s body to create a chill that heightens sensitivity.

  • Warm Oils: Warm some edible oils, and allow your tongue to mix the heat with the taste of the oil on your partner’s skin.

4. Food Play with Lick Sex

Food can be a fun and sensual addition to lick sex. Classes and workshops on food play underscore how it can serve as a catalyst for intimacy. Think strawberries, chocolate, honey, or whipped cream.

Pro Tip: Instead of simply feeding each other, get creative—drizzle chocolate on the skin and lick it off. This brings an element of playfulness while also engaging both taste and touch.

Incorporating Mindfulness and Presence

Mindfulness plays a crucial role in enhancing sexual experiences, including lick sex. Being fully present can amplify arousal and intimacy. Here’s how to incorporate mindfulness into your encounters:

1. Breath Awareness

Focus on your breathing. Slow, deep breaths can help ground both partners and build anticipation. Syncing your breath with your partner can create a rhythm to your activities.

2. Sensory Focusing

As you lick and explore, pay attention to the sensations—both yours and your partner’s. Notice the warmth of their skin, the saltiness or sweetness of their taste, and the sounds of pleasure. This focused attention can create a deeper emotional connection and a more satisfying experience.

3. Emotional Check-Ins

Throughout your exploration, pause to check in with each other. A simple “How does that feel?” can not only provide feedback but enhance intimacy and communication.

The Importance of Aftercare

Aftercare is an integral part of any sexual experience, especially those involving high intimacy like lick sex. Understanding and addressing each other’s emotional and physical needs after your intimate encounter fosters further connection and trust.

1. Physical Affection

Cuddling, gentle touching, or kissing after licking can reinforce the bond and provide comfort, allowing both partners to bask in the afterglow of their shared experience.

2. Verbal Connection

Discussing what you enjoyed or how you felt during the encounter can enhance future experiences. Sharing feelings fosters trust and a deeper emotional connection.

3. Hydration and Snacks

Licking is an energetic exchange, and staying hydrated is essential. Having water or light snacks available can be a sweet way to transition back to your everyday lives.
